随着数字经济的快速发展,区块链技术逐渐成为各行各业关注的焦点。近年来,TokenimRC作为一个新兴的区块链平台,...
随着虚拟货币的普及和区块链技术的不断发展,越来越多的用户希望使用钱包应用来管理和交易虚拟货币。imtoken作为一款知名的钱包应用,具有简洁易用、安全可靠的特点,因此开发类似imtoken的钱包应用能满足用户的需求。
开发类似imtoken的钱包应用需要以下步骤:
1) 确定技术栈和开发语言:选择适合的技术栈和开发语言,如React Native、Flutter等。
2) 设计用户界面:通过UI设计工具创建用户界面,包括钱包账户管理、交易功能等。
3) 钱包功能开发:实现钱包的核心功能,如账户管理、转账、交易记录等。
4) 钱包安全性处理:确保钱包的安全,如私钥保护、数据加密等。
5) 与区块链网络集成:将钱包应用与区块链网络进行集成,使其能够与区块链进行通信。
6) 钱包测试和:进行测试,修复bug并对应用进行,提升用户体验。
开发类似imtoken的钱包应用需要掌握以下技术知识:
1) 前端开发技术:HTML、CSS、JavaScript等。
2) 移动应用开发框架:React Native、Flutter等。
3) 区块链技术:了解基本的区块链概念、智能合约等。
4) 数据库管理:掌握数据库操作和管理,如SQLite、Realm等。
5) 安全性处理:了解密码学、数据加密等相关知识,保护用户的私钥和数据。
确保类似imtoken的钱包应用的安全性需要注意以下方面:
1) 私钥的保护:使用安全的密码学算法加密用户的私钥,并在设备上存储加密后的私钥。
2) 数据加密:对用户的敏感数据进行加密,如交易记录、用户信息等。
3) 防止恶意攻击:通过防火墙、安全协议等措施防止恶意攻击。
4) 定期更新和修复漏洞:及时更新应用版本,修复已知的安全漏洞。
5) 审计与监控:对应用的安全进行定期审计和监控,确保应用运行的安全性。
提高类似imtoken的钱包应用的用户体验需要注意以下方面:
1) 简洁易用的界面设计:设计简洁、直观的用户界面,让用户能够快速上手操作。
2) 快速响应和加载:应用的性能,确保快速响应和数据加载。
3) 多语言支持:提供多语言支持,满足不同用户的语言需求。
4) 实时通知和提醒:通过推送通知等方式,向用户提供实时的交易状态和重要信息。
5) 用户反馈和需求收集:主动征求用户反馈,改进应用并满足用户的需求。
推广类似imtoken的钱包应用需要采取以下措施:
1) 社交媒体宣传:通过社交平台、行业论坛等渠道积极宣传应用的功能和优势。
2) 媒体合作:与区块链媒体合作,进行品牌宣传和推广。
3) 用户口碑传播:鼓励用户分享应用使用体验,提供奖励机制以促进用户的口碑传播。
4) :应用的关键词、页面标题等,提高搜索引擎的排名。
5) 合作伙伴推广:与区块链项目、交易所等合作,进行互惠互利的推广合作。
6) 专业评估和认证:申请相关的评估和认证标志,增加用户对应用的信任度。
类似imtoken的钱包应用的盈利模式可以包括以下几种:
1) 手续费收入:通过用户的转账和交易收取一定比例的手续费。
2) 广告收入:在应用界面中展示合适的广告,并从广告商获得广告费用。
3) 代币发行和众筹:作为钱包应用,可以支持代币的发行和众筹,以此获得一定的收入。
4) 合作伙伴收入:与其他区块链项目、交易所等合作,通过推广合作获得收入。
5) 增值服务收入:提供增值服务,如数据分析报告、交易提醒等,并向用户收取一定费用。
未来类似imtoken的钱包应用的发展趋势包括以下几个方面:
1) 更多的功能:除了基本的钱包功能,应用将提供更多的功能,如DApp浏览器、去中心化交易等。
2) 跨链支持:支持不同区块链网络的资产管理和跨链交易。
3) 安全性增强:采用更先进的密码学算法和安全机制,保障用户资产的安全。
4) 社交和共享功能:融入社交和共享元素,提供更多互动和社区建设。
5) 无需信任的钱包:通过使用密码学技术和去中心化的方案,实现无需信任的钱包。
6) 跨平台支持:跨平台适配,支持多种操作系统和设备。
7) 用户体验:不断提升用户体验,让应用更加简单易用和高效稳定。
8) 法律合规:遵循相关法律法规,确保应用符合合规要求。